WebOct 14, 2024 · In 1969 under the Indira Gandhi Government, 14 banks were nationalised. These banks, during that time, held 80% of the bank deposits in the country. The banks that were nationalised in 1969 are: Allahabad Bank. Bank of Baroda. Bank of India. Bank of Maharashtra. Central Bank of India. Canara Bank.

WebCurrency regulator or bank of issue: Central banks possess the exclusive right to manufacture notes in an economy. All the central banks across the world are involved in issuing notes to the economy.
